How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 32162?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
32162 Studio Apartments | $1,550 | $1,350 | $2,471 |
32162 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,426 | $1,041 | $1,724 |
32162 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,774 | $1,245 | $2,300 |
32162 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,139 | $1,199 | $2,649 |
32162 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,234 | $1,579 | $2,445 |
